FATHER of Timilehin Ajayi, the gospel singer arrested for allegedly killing a member of the National Youth Service Corps (NYSC), Salome Adaidu, has pleaded for the release of his son.
Ajayi was found in possession of the severed head of Salome Adaidu, 24, in a polythene bag and has been remanded in a correctional facility on the orders of a Nasarawa State High Court.
The gruesome incident reportedly occurred in Agwan Sarki, Orozo, a community near the Federal Capital Territory (FCT).
While the family of Salome continues to grieve, Ajayi’s father is pleading for his release. He made the plea during an interview wherein he said: “I want the government to help me so that the matter is settled. I want them to help me beg so that he is released”, he said.
However, quite contrary to the position of the father, the mother of the suspected murderer said she had left everything for the government to handle.
“If it were one of my daughters they did that to, how would I feel?” She asked rhetorically.
“So the government can do anything they want to do. Everything is in their hands,” She concluded
Ajayi, who gained some recognition after releasing his album ‘God of the Earth’ in 2020, admitted to murdering and dismembering the body of the hapless Benue State-born youth corps member. He also claimed he took the action on discovering that the deceased was cheating on him. He said he has no regrets over his actions.
The family of the deceased however counter this position insisting they were never in any relationship.
According to the family, their daughter unfortunately boarded the wrong Keke NAPEP leading to her abduction and subsequent murder. They also said she was scheduled to be engaged to a pharmacist immediately upon completion of her NYSC programme.
